The Art of Romantic Gift Giving

GalleryBeallaeuIs Cupid in your corner this year? Saint Valentine’s Day is just around the bend and for those who believe in L-O-V-E (or not!) here’s a few creative ways to support local artists — or be one yourself — and make the most out of one romantic day.

The cliché of flowers may run a different angle if you’re Chris Belleau of Belleau Gallery. His hand-blown glass roses are a perfect gift for the blossom lover. For a more ‘heart’ felt offering, he also crafts unique glass hearts that make beautiful keepsakes. 424 Wickenden St, Providence. 401-456-0011, gallerybelleau.com

For another artistic twist on a classic, check out DEMI Artistic, an emerging artist from Providence. Select one (or several…) small floral paintings on February 12 (one night only) at the Courthouse Center for the Arts at a special Valentine’s Day price. DEMI is taking orders for special flowers if you would like to make advanced purchases.  They’ll be available for pickup at Amy’s Place on Wickenden on February 13 — just in time for that special someone. She recently added Monarch and Alexandra Birdwing butterfly waterproof sculptures to her collection. They make a wonderful additions to succulents or garden arrangements. Amy’s Place, 214 Wickenden St, Providence. 401-274-9966, DEMIArtistic.com, Courthousearts.org

Considering a special piece of jewelry? Local 3U Design Studios has a variety of hand embossed fashion bangles.  With several design patterns, “LOVE,” “Touching Hearts” or “XOs” are well worth the investment. 508-695-2551, 3Udesignstudios.com

For a statement piece of jewelry with a luxe bohemian vibe, Katima Jewelry has that special adornment your lady will love. These distinct necklaces are made of semi-precious stones, antique trade beads and unique ornamentations sourced from places like Tibet, Nepal and Africa. Get one before Valentine’s Day for a special holiday discount. 401-439-1612, KatimaJewelry.com

For a more permanent choice, Urban Artifacts Tattoo is running a special on tattoos from now until Valentine’s Day. Buy one and get one half-off or choose a small cursive name, and get the other name free. 1882 Smith St, North Providence. 401-432-6484, facebook.com/Urbanartifactstattoo

Let’s not forget about the card. It’s a big deal! StudioLolo2, created by a local Warren artist Laurel Gaylord, is running a special on multiple Valentine’s Day cards for those of you with multiple Valentines. etsy.com/shop/StudioLolo2

Another local artist, Phil Ayoub, founder of Bow Ties Greeting Cards and other gifts, has some wildly wicked cards that will fit any occasion. He just released some brandy new designs for the realist-romantic in you. Hope Artiste Village, 1005 Main St, Pawtucket. 401-641-1116, BowTiesGreetingCards.com

Wanna include the family in a day of fun and education? The Providence Children’s Museum is having a “Heart Smart” event on February 13 and 14. Learn about the heart with activities, anatomy lessons and more. 100 South St, Providence. 401-273-5437, ChildrenMuseum.org

Live music — yes! Spend an evening at The Park Theatre where The Beach Boys will provide a special St. Valentine’s performance. Tickets can be purchased with or without a special dinner buffet prior to the concert. Parking is free. 848 Park Ave, Cranston. 401-467-7275, ParkTheatreRI.com
